you have no clue, have you?
Radeon 9000 mobility = R9100IGP
DRI is NOT a driver, DRI is NOT an API
DRI is just an interface to talk to the card. OpenGL is an API, "Radeon" is the driver.

you HAVE openGL, otherwise you could NOT run any Q3 based game.
